The BEGE Flange Encoder MIG Nova+ MN-250-28-2048-12 is an incremental encoder with high resolution and enhanced signal stability, ideal for precise control in automated systems. Key attributes: Outer diameter: 250 mm, Flange BCD: 215 mm, Flange thickness: 12 mm, Shaft diameter: 28 mm, IEC norm: 100/112B5, Pulse rate: 2048 pulses/rev/channel, Cable length: 2 m, Input voltage: 5–24VDC, Output: A90°B / A'90°B' HTL/TTL, Material: aluminium, IP rating: IP55 / IP67. Encoder standard: BCD norm 215. Suitable for demanding motion and feedback applications in industrial automation.

Key Features and Benefits:
High-Resolution Incremental Encoder – Delivers 2048 pulses per revolution per channel, providing highly accurate speed and position feedback for demanding automation tasks.
Enhanced Signal Stability – Improved signal quality ensures precise and reliable measurements, reducing errors in servo control and automated processes.
Robust Construction – Manufactured from durable aluminium and rated IP55/IP67, the encoder is resistant to dust, moisture, and vibration, delivering long-lasting performance in harsh industrial settings.
Flexible Output – Supports both HTL and TTL interfaces (A90°B / A'90°B'), compatible with a wide range of control systems.
Wide Input Voltage – Operates from 5-24VDC, offering versatility for different industrial environments and system architectures.
Comprehensive Compatibility – Designed for integration with IEC 100/112B5 motors, featuring a 28mm shaft diameter and 250mm outer/flange diameter for straightforward retrofitting or replacement.
Convenient Installation – 2-meter cable and 12mm flange thickness enable easy, flexible mounting and connection in control cabinets or directly on equipment.

Encoder Comparison:
MIG Basic – Incremental encoder for standard speed feedback in basic automation tasks.
MIG Nova+ – Incremental encoder with high resolution and outstanding signal stability for precise regulation in automated systems.
MIG AST – Absolute encoder, retaining position data after power loss, designed for high-precision positioning and advanced control systems.
